The Importance of Jewelry Photography in eCommerce

According to the 2017 Global Online Consumer Report, retailers who are looking to drive sales online must learn to present their products strategically to convince shoppers. Specifically, this call pertains to those products that shoppers are less willing to purchase sight unseen. One of these strategies, as the report outlines, is the inclusion of high-quality, detailed photographs. It’s even better if the photographs enable a 360-product view and have a zoom capability.

In fact, one of the reasons shoppers forego shopping online is the lack of touch. Fifty -six percent of 18,430 shoppers had expressed a desire to see and touch the product before making a purchase. However, this doesn’t mean that an online presence isn’t significant in jewelry selling. It’s true that shoppers still desire in-store experience, but two-thirds of the surveyed shoppers research online before purchasing in store. Needless to say, if your jewelry pictures look lackluster so are your opportunities to sell as thousands of potential shoppers may have seen your products online but are less likely to make connections with your amateurish jewelry pictures.

L. G. Humphries & Sons is an Australian jewelry business of three generations. It was established in 1939 and has since made a name in the jewelry industry. The shop is located on the busy street of Castlereagh near David Jones. Its products range from diamond rings, pendants, ornaments, expensive watches, and antique jewelry pieces.

The GemLightbox is a real solution to the business since most of its antique pieces get picked up within hours of uploading onto Facebook, it’s important for them to take photos of those pieces quickly and beautifully both for selling and internal documentation purposes. In addition, the quality of the photos had improved significantly that it becomes evident in its social media engagement. Check out the before and after social media photos of the business below. The social media engagement has increased by a tremendous 1000%.
